(1) The Education Services for Overseas Students (ESOS) Act 2000 and the National Code of Practice mandate particular tuition fee refund entitlements for overseas students studying in Australia. (2) The Enrolment Policy and the Student Fees Policy provide the institutional policy framework for all University fees and refunds matters. The International Student Fees and Refund Agreement (the Agreement) provides additional details to ensure overseas students' particular consumer rights are protected. (3) From 1 July 2012, the Tuition Protection Services legislation further strengthens the financial protection of international students. Streamlined Visa Processing, also introduced from 24 March 2012 provides additional safeguards for genuine students and universities. (4) The International Student Fees and Refund Agreement contains all relevant definitions. (5) The University of Western Sydney provides all prospective overseas students with an ESOS compliant fees and refund agreement as part of the recruitment and enrolment process. (6) The Agreement is provided as part of the International Offer Pack and is therefore part of the written agreement between each overseas student and the University.
